Canvas vs. Canvass
A heavy fabric versus a survey of opinions.
The comparisoni
“We need to canvass the users for their feedback.”

The ruleiii
¶
CANVAS = a heavy, coarse cloth (noun).
They are homophones. In marketing and user research, 'canvass' is used frequently, but people often default to the simpler 'canvas'.
Memory aidiv
Remember it like this
CanvaSS has two S's for 'Survey' or 'Seeking Support'.
